Commodity Junkie
Didn't realize how mundane regular Bluetooth was until I got this.

I paired this with my Bowers & Wilkins Px7 S2 headphones. They make the regular bluetooth codecs found on Android and Windows devices - like AAC and SBC - sound muffled and flat. The aptX HD codec is the way to go if your device supports it. The latter provides more than adequate bandwidth of 576Kbps at 24-bit/48kHz. You really can't do better unless you go with a USB-C cable and an expensive PC motherboard. The only cons: 1.) Early teething issues when pairing. 2.) And then there's the fact you can't get this to fit on your phone if it's wearing a case.

S. Maura
Sync issues, hard to pair

Had a hard time detecting 3 different headphones. Once they finally paired, the sound kept breaking up or having issues or stopping altogether until I played around with the frequency settings. On the Airpods Pro 2 the left and right audio are out of sync on PC, have to frequently put them in the charging box and take them out again. The manual states to download the Windows app to access more features, but the app was hard to find on the website. After finding and installing it, I tried frequency changes, driver updates, firmware and headphone resets to try to get things to be seamless. Let’s just say that did not work to make my life easier. It does sound great after you get it all working, but I don’t need a ritual every time I want to use headphones.

Pat Mice
Not Worth It

When properly connected, the sound quality and volume are great but getting connecting is incredibly annoying. I use it exclusively on PS5. Very slow to connect, then it immediately disconnects and console audio output switches to TV speakers even though I have automatic audio switching turned off. Have to fight with it for a few minutes before it finally stays connected. I stand at the console when I connect and the furthest I ever move away from it is maybe 10 feet. Does the same thing with all of my earbuds ... different types and brands. I have zero problems with a bluetooth gaming headset that has a dedicated dongle. (No, it's not plugged in or connected at the same time that I'm using this audio adapter.) The gaming headset connects easily, stays connected and doesn't change the console's audio output when turned off. Conclusion: Overpriced and not worth the aggravation.
